LVDS1: Dual LVDS Channel (2.0mm)
Pin No. Signal Pin No. Signal
1 VBL (+12V) 2 VBL (+12V)
3 GND 4 GND
5 DISP.ON/OFF 6 GND
7 LVDD 8 LVDD
9 GND 10 GND
11 TxO0+ 12 TxO0-
13 TxO1+ 14 TxO1-
15 TxO2+ 16 TxO2-
17 TxO3+ 18 TxO3-
19 TxOC+ 20 TxOC-
21 GND 22 KEY
23 TxE0+ 24 TxE0-
25 TxE1+ 26 TxE1-
27 TxE2+ 28 TxE2-
29 TxE3+ 30 TxE3-
31 TxEC+ 32 TxEC-
33 LVDD 34 LVDD
35 GND 36 GND
37 GND 38 GND
39 VBL (+12V) 40 VBL (+12V)
Please make sure the Pin 1 location before inserting the LCD connector.

2-2. Installing Memory
ENDAT-4066i system board offers one 184pin DDR SDRAM socket supports up to
1GB memory and the speed can be 200/ 266/ 333/ 400.
2-3. Shared VGA Memory
ENDAT-4066i is using built-in AGP VGA controller with INTEL DVMT up to 96MB of
system memory. The amount of video memory on motherboard determines the
number of colors and the video graphic resolution.

2-5. Assigning IRQs for Expansion Cards
Some expansion cards require an IRQ (Interrupt request vector) to operate.
Generally, each IRQ must be exclusively assigned to specific use. In a standard
design, there are 16 IRQ available with 11 of them already in used by other part of
the system.
Some PCI expansion cards need IRQ; any remaining IRQ could be assigned to PCI
Bus. Microsoft's Diagnostic (MSD.EXE) utility included in the Windows directory
can be used to see their map. Clients can not have more than one device apply the
same IRQ in the system or it will cause the system hang up, crash, and unexpected
results. To simplify the process, this motherboard complies with the Plug and Play
(PnP) specifications, which was developed to allow automatic system configuration.
Whenever a PnP-compliant card is added to the system, PnP card and IRQs will
automatically assigned if available. The PCI and PnP configuration in the BIOS
setup utility can indicate which IRQs have being used by Legacy cards.
